Bastien’s Restaurant. 3501 East Colfax, down the street a bit from the state capital building, and just a hop, skip and a jump from the Molly Brown house(Titanic survivor).Web site is:Bastiensrestaurant.com . 303/322-8363. Been family owned in Denver since 1937. Once known as Bastien’s Rotunda, it is located in a round building. The dining area is open, with tables on various levels. Be prepared to take a retro trip back. Very neat atmosphere. Their signature dish is a 16 oz. New York sugar steak, currenly going for $22.95. The sugar does not infuse itself as far as flavor is concerned. What it does is capture the juices in the steak and cause it to be one of the best tasting steaks around. Recently took out of town guests there who said it was one of the best steaks they ever had, and they just loved the atmosphere.
